云搜是一种基于云计算技术的搜索引擎服务,它利用分布式计算和大数据处理能力,为用户提供快速、准确的搜索结果。双十一活动期间,云搜可能会面临巨大的流量和查询请求,因此需要特别注意其性能和稳定性。
基础概念
云搜的核心在于利用云计算资源来处理和索引大量的数据,并通过分布式架构来提高搜索效率和响应速度。它通常包括以下几个组件:
- 数据采集层:负责从各种数据源收集数据。
- 数据处理层:对收集到的数据进行清洗、去重、索引等处理。
- 搜索引擎层:实现搜索算法,处理用户的查询请求并返回结果。
- 用户接口层:提供用户交互界面,展示搜索结果。
优势
- 高可扩展性:能够根据需求动态调整计算资源。
- 高性能:通过分布式计算提高搜索速度和处理能力。
- 低成本:按需使用资源,避免了传统服务器的高昂维护成本。
- 灵活性:支持多种数据源和自定义搜索逻辑。
类型
云搜服务可以根据不同的应用场景分为以下几种类型:
- 通用搜索引擎:适用于各种网站和应用。
- 垂直搜索引擎:专注于特定行业或领域的数据搜索。
- 实时搜索引擎:能够处理和索引实时数据流。
应用场景
- 电商平台:快速查找商品信息,提升用户体验。
- 新闻网站:实时更新和检索新闻内容。
- 社交媒体:搜索用户生成的内容和社交关系。
- 企业内部搜索:帮助员工查找公司内部文档和资源。
双十一活动期间的挑战
双十一期间,电商平台会面临极高的流量和查询请求,云搜可能会遇到以下问题:
- 性能瓶颈:大量并发请求可能导致服务器响应缓慢。
- 数据延迟:实时数据处理可能出现延迟,影响搜索结果的准确性。
- 系统稳定性:高负载可能导致系统崩溃或服务中断。
解决方案
- 负载均衡:使用负载均衡技术将请求分散到多个服务器上,避免单点故障。
- 负载均衡:使用负载均衡技术将请求分散到多个服务器上,避免单点故障。
- 缓存机制:使用缓存技术存储热门查询结果,减少数据库压力。
- 缓存机制:使用缓存技术存储热门查询结果,减少数据库压力。
- 自动扩展:配置自动扩展策略,根据流量动态增加或减少服务器资源。
- 自动扩展:配置自动扩展策略,根据流量动态增加或减少服务器资源。
- 监控和报警:实时监控系统性能,设置报警机制以便及时发现和处理问题。
- 监控和报警:实时监控系统性能,设置报警机制以便及时发现和处理问题。
通过以上措施,可以有效应对双十一活动期间的高流量挑战,确保云搜服务的稳定性和高性能。